Output 3c4ef3236877222dab2e8cd4fcbd6d7dfe491545fc577cf9eaec139dcf42ae87:7

value
145376
script pubkey
OP_0 OP_PUSHBYTES_32 b93d452b800f6ef6d905dcbe18eab91968221cb93fd9de86da4d453f777c4342
address
bc1qhy7522uqpah0dkg9mjlp364er95zy89e8lvaapk6f4zn7amugdpq6w54at
transaction
3c4ef3236877222dab2e8cd4fcbd6d7dfe491545fc577cf9eaec139dcf42ae87
confirmations
912
spent
true